Consider the Individual Factors

There are many factors to consider in determining proper CBD dosage. One of the first ones you need to look into is the individual factors. Let’s zoom in at one of the most crucial factors: your weight.

Your weight may affect the efficacy of the CBD product. Though some sectors contest this factor, the CBD must first go through your tissues before reaching your endocannabinoid system. Hence, the heavier you are, the longer the CBD and its effects will reach their peak.

Other factors also affect the absorption of CBD in relation to your weight. Firstly, the distribution rate measures how fast CBD reaches different organs of your body. This is crucial, considering different parts of the body have receptors with varying acceptance rates.

Secondly, there is the absorption rate. This pertains to how fast your endocannabinoid system reacts with CBD. Lastly, there is the metabolic rate, which deals with how fast your body can metabolize CBD.

The Form of CBD Matters

The kind of CBD product you are planning to take is also a key factor in terms of dosage. There are three main types of CBD you can take. There is the isolate, the broad-spectrum, and the full-spectrum.

An isolate CBD contains nothing but pure CBD. When taking isolates, the key is to start at a low dosage. Ideally, take 25mg of the CBD isolate on your first day. If you feel that the effects of 25mg are quite strong, reduce to 10mg on your second day.

If not, stick to 25mg on day 2, as well as on the third day. On the fourth day, you can increase your dosage a bit. Go for anywhere between 35mg and 50mg max until you reach the effects that you want.

On the fifth day, stick to the 35mg to 50mg range if you already achieved your desired results. If the effects are too much, reduce your intake to 25mg.

Meanwhile, the broad spectrum comes with CBD, as well as other forms of cannabinoids. What it doesn’t contain is Tetrahydrocannabinol or THC. It is the mind-altering ingredient that you find in marijuana.

As for a full-spectrum, it contains everything from CBD, other cannabinoids, and THC.

Align with Your Medical Condition

Another factor that affects CBD dosage is your current medical condition. People use CBD products to help treat or manage a myriad of health issues. Thus, you need to consider the symptoms you wish to ease when determining the right dosage.

Keep in mind that various conditions require different dosages. CBD dosage for pain may not be the same as CBD oil dosage for anxiety.

Thankfully, some studies give us acceptable estimates concerning the dosages for various conditions. If you wish to relieve anxiety symptoms, 300mg to 600mg of CBD should do the trick.

If you wish to improve your sleep at night, 25mg of CBD a day will do wonders. In case you have a bowel disease, 10mg should be enough to give relief.

You may also hear stories of people taking CBD products to manage more serious medical concerns. Though CBD is not a drug, studies point to different benefits of CBD in managing serious health conditions.

People with Parkinson’s disease may benefit from taking 75mg to 300mg of CBD daily. Patients suffering from psychosis may find relief by taking 600mg of CBD a day. Even people battling cancer also take CBD for pain management.

Decide on the Form

You also need to pick the form of CBD that best suits your needs. If you want quick relief, especially for anxiety and muscle cramps, a CBD vape pen is your best bet. If you want something that takes effect after a few minutes, CBD oil drops are what you need.

If you want something you can enjoy in the form of a drink, you can go for CBD-infused coffee. The effects, however, will take much longer.
